Lots of people say EB Titchener, EC Tolman, EG Boring, and EL Thorndike. Usually it is because they used this form of their name in publication. In SKinner's case, he never use his first name "Burrhus." He went by the diminutive of his middle name, "Fred." Chris Green York U.
